Thanks to everyone who participated, and everyone who came out to enjoy the food, the drink, the friendship and the music. Errol Strouse took 1st prize this year by singing "Blueberry Hill" and "Don't". Tied for 2nd place were Brenda Frankenstein and Tara Hess. All three were featured in our Best of Open Mic night Friday April 3rd, along with finalist Reiley Lonergan and Open Mic frequenter Tony Seo (who "made some music on the guitar"). The Lazy Dog is a great venue for all kinds of special events, and music is an integral part of who we are and what we do. Our 2nd annual TOP DOG competition will start Sunday Feb 21st next year. Why so many people--including many under 21--chose to stop at the Lazy Dog without dinner reservations on that particular evening, we don't know.  As you said, "there was not enough room to fit everyone".  All tables were occupied and the standing-room-only crowd was blocking walkways and exits.  There also weren't enough Lazy Dog staff "supervisors" (as defined by the PLCB) to allow minors who were not seated at table with adult/parental supervision to stay in the coffeehouse.  It was our concern for the safety and comfort of all our guests--plus building code and PLCB requirements--that forced us to ask unseated guests--including unsupervised minors--to leave.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;As a business, we want the Lazy Dog to be about great hospitality, great coffee, great food and great music.  We want people of all ages--especially coffee-, food- and music-lovers--to be a part of the Lazy Dog all day and every day.  On Friday &amp;amp; Saturday nights, guests help us to support live music in Schuylkill County by paying a cover charge to hear professional bands and by buying food and drink.  On Thursday nights, guests support Open Mic &amp;amp; Karaoke by contributing to the hat-pass--with the requested $2.00 contribution used to buy &amp;amp; maintain Open Mic &amp;amp; Karaoke equipment &amp;amp; advertising--and by buying food and drink.  We're committed to continue Open Mic at the Lazy Dog as an opportunity for local performers, fun-lovers and friends to try new material &amp;amp; enjoy one another as long as our guests continue to support Open Mic.  But, we're also committed to comply with building-, health- and PLCB-codes (yup, BS!) that will keep our guests safe &amp;amp; legal...and will keep us in business.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Consider this:  It may be possible for us to arrange an Under-21 Night on a Sunday evening to accommodate you and the others who were inconvenienced on August 21st.  It would involve significant effort on our part:  contacting the PLCB to receive written authorization (yup, more bureaucratic BS) and scheduling &amp;amp; paying Lazy Dog kitchen, counter, serving and sound-tech staff .  It would involve significant effort on your part, too:  lining up the performers and finding an audience who's willing to contribute to a hat-pass and to buy food and drink.   Let us know when/if you'd like to discuss something like this.  In the meanwhile, we're still sorry that we couldn't make room for you and so many others in August.
